Architectural Vulnerability: The Danger of Centralized Data

The most critical vulnerability in automated privacy software is the architecture itself. To remove your data from the public domain, conventional platforms require you to first centralize it.

Platforms like DeleteMe operate on a standard SaaS model. To fuel their automated API scripts, you must input your complete identity—current and historical addresses, phone numbers, aliases, and family connections—into their database. This creates an immediate paradox. To protect your privacy, you are forced to compile a master dossier of your physical and digital provenance, storing it indefinitely on a third-party server.

This architecture creates a massive, high-value honeypot. A single breach of this centralized database exposes the exact intelligence you sought to conceal. When evaluating threat models, most analyses focus solely on the number of brokers a service scans. They entirely ignore the attack vector created by the privacy tool itself. Centralizing sensitive intelligence is a strategic liability. You are simply shifting your exposure from disparate data brokers to a single, highly targeted repository.

Tactile Eradication vs. Automated API Opt-Outs

Automated privacy tools operate on a flawed thesis. They assume data brokers act in good faith and maintain standardized API endpoints for opt-outs. This is a critical miscalculation. When you rely on automated scripts, you are only addressing the surface layer of data exposure.

Platforms like DeleteMe dispatch programmatic requests to a static list of aggregators. If a broker alters their site structure, ignores the API ping, or obscures records behind complex CAPTCHAs, the automated system registers a false positive or simply fails. It cannot negotiate, it cannot adapt, and it completely misses deep-web mentions, localized property records, voter rolls, and historical aliases. The system provides the illusion of security while leaving critical vulnerabilities exposed.
